An iPhone that refuses to connect to iTunes can halt your entire digital ecosystem, leaving you unable to back up critical data, restore from a backup, or sync new media. This issue often appears without warning and can stem from a variety of sources, ranging from a simple loose cable to deep-seated software conflicts. Understanding the specific conditions that trigger this failure is the first step toward a reliable resolution.
Initial Verification Steps
Before diving into complex troubleshooting, it is essential to rule out the most basic variables that cause connectivity failures. Many users immediately assume a software problem exists when the issue is purely physical or environmental. Taking a moment to verify the fundamentals can save significant time and frustration.
Cable and Port Inspection
Worn-out USB cables are the most frequent culprits behind connection issues. The constant bending of Lightning or USB-C cables weakens the internal wiring, leading to data connectivity without power, or vice versa. You should inspect the cable for kinks, fraying, or exposed wires. Furthermore, dust and debris can accumulate in the charging port of the iPhone and the USB ports of your computer, creating a poor electrical connection. A quick check with a flashlight can reveal obstructions that prevent a secure link.
USB Port and Power Management
Not all USB ports are created equal when it comes to syncing an iPhone. Standard USB ports on the front of a desktop case or on older hubs may lack the necessary amperage to initialize a trust connection between the devices. It is recommended to plug the cable directly into a high-speed USB 2.0 or 3.0 port located on the back of your desktop PC. Laptop users should avoid using battery power alone; connecting the laptop to AC power often stabilizes the voltage and allows iTunes to recognize the device immediately.
Software and Trust Dynamics
Once the physical connection is verified, the problem usually resides in the software layer. iOS devices operate on a trust-based system with computers, which requires explicit permission to allow access to the device's data. If this trust relationship is corrupted or the computer is not authorized, iTunes will fail to establish a session.
Establishing Trust
When you connect your iPhone to a computer, a prompt should appear on the device asking if you trust the connected computer. If you dismiss this prompt, select "Don't Trust," or if the prompt never appears, the link is not authenticated. To fix this, you must unlock the phone, navigate to Settings > General > Reset, and select "Reset Location & Privacy." This action clears all trusted computers, allowing you to reconnect and grant permission anew when you plug the device in again.
iTunes and Driver Integrity
Outdated software is a common barrier to communication. Apple frequently releases updates for iTunes that include updated device support files for the latest iOS versions. If you are running an older version of iTunes, your software may not recognize the handshake signals sent by the current iOS firmware on your iPhone. Ensure that both iTunes and the associated Apple Mobile Device Support component are updated to their latest versions. On Windows systems, missing or corrupt USB drivers can also block the connection; reinstalling the Apple USB Driver via Device Manager can resolve these low-level communication errors.
Advanced Configuration Conflicts
When basic steps fail, the issue often involves security software or system settings that interfere with the data transfer protocol. These conflicts are particularly common on Windows machines but can also occur on macOS.
Firewall and Antivirus Interference
Security applications are designed to monitor and restrict data flow between devices. Sometimes, they incorrectly flag the communication between iTunes and the iPhone as a security threat, blocking the connection entirely. Temporarily disabling your firewall or antivirus software can confirm if this is the cause. If the connection succeeds while the security is disabled, you must create an inbound rule to allow iTunes.exe through the firewall or add the application to the exclusion list.